How lie angle interacts with your swing

Every golfer has a swing footprint: tendencies, tempo, and release patterns shape how club geometry translates into flight. A correctly fitted lie angle helps promote square impact, reduces unwanted toe or heel mis-hits, and supports consistent directional control. For players with a steep, in-to-out path, a lie that’s a touch more upright can help keep the sole from digging and producing hooks. For those with a shallow path and a tendency to slice, a flatter lie can assist in steering toward target.

Measuring lie angle: from report to reality

Lie angle is typically measured with specialized fittings tools that simulate address position and club impact. In many fitting sessions, you’ll see a chart showing lie angle alongside loft, shaft type, and swing weight. While online diagrams are helpful, the most reliable assessment comes from a fitting professional who can observe your setup, battery of impact checks, and track data across multiple clubs.

Practical tip: a common starting point is to compare your current lie angle against a known reference (your height, posture, and how you address the ball). If you notice persistent toe-up contact or heel-first contact, it’s worth exploring a professional lie adjustment as part of a broader fitting plan.

Practical adjustments you can discuss with a fitter

  • Incremental adjustments: Lie angle is not a one-size-fits-all spec. Expect small changes (1–2 degrees) to begin dialing in consistency.
  • Club-to-club consistency: If several clubs show similar mis-hits, a unified lie adjustment across the set can create a more uniform impact pattern.
  • Path and face angle interplay: Lie angle works in concert with your path and clubface orientation. A fitter will often balance lie with loft and shaft selection to stabilize dispersion.
